Notatka
Dostęp do tej strony wymaga autoryzacji. Może spróbować zalogować się lub zmienić katalogi.
Dostęp do tej strony wymaga autoryzacji. Możesz spróbować zmienić katalogi.
Sterownik magistrali audio HD jest jedynym składnikiem oprogramowania, który bezpośrednio uzyskuje dostęp do rejestrów sprzętowych kontrolera interfejsu magistrali audio HD. Sterownik magistrali udostępnia DDI audio HD, które jego elementy podrzędne — instancje sterowników funkcji kontrolujących kodeki audio i modemowe — mogą używać do programowania sprzętu kontrolera audio HD. Ponadto kierowca magistrali zarządza zasobami sprzętowymi łącza audio HD, które obejmują silniki DMA i przepustowość magistrali. Sterowniki funkcji przydzielają i zwalniają te zasoby za pośrednictwem DDI audio HD.
Sterownik magistrali audio HD:
Wysyła zapytanie do kodeków na szynie i tworzy obiekty podrzędne do zarządzania kodekami.
Obsługuje procedury usługi przerwania (ISR) w przypadku niepożądanych odpowiedzi i propaguje niepożądane odpowiedzi do swoich dzieci.
Przekazuje polecenia z elementów podrzędnych do kodeków i pobiera odpowiedzi z kodeków.
Konfiguruje silniki DMA, które przesyłają dane do lub z cyklicznych buforów.
Zarządza zasobami przepustowości magistrali w linku audio HD.
Zapewnia dostęp do rejestrów zegarów ściennych i rejestrów położenia łącza.
Zapewnia synchronizowane uruchamianie i zatrzymywanie grup strumieni.
Sterownik magistrali audio HD nie zapewnia:
Interfejs do programowania dsp lub innych rejestrów, które nie są zdefiniowane w specyfikacji audio intel high definition.
Priorytetowe zarządzanie przepustowością.
Podczas enumeracji urządzeń sterownik magistrali audio HD wykrywa kodeki dołączone do łącza audio HD w kontrolerze audio HD. Dla każdego kodera koder magistrali ładuje jeden sterownik funkcji (jeśli jest dostępny) dla każdej grupy funkcji, która znajduje się w koderze. Aby uzyskać informacje o grupach funkcji, zobacz specyfikację audio intel high definition w witrynie internetowej intel HD audio .